If your computer or laptop BIOS looses its date/time on reboot and display error messages like " system option not set" or "CMOS checksum invalid", it means that the CMOS battery needs to be changed.
The CMOS (Complementary metal-oxide-semiconductor) battery powers your Computer BIOS firmware. When the CMOS battery starts to lose power and strength, the BIOS starts to lose data and the computer can begin to not work correctly.
